Azerbaijan's insurance market grows 14%
Finance
- 23 February, 2023
- 11:53
In January 2023, 133.948 million manats ($78.79 million) in insurance premiums were collected through 20 insurance companies in Azerbaijan, 13.7% more year-on-year, Report informs, citing the Central Bank of Azerbaijan.
During the reporting period, the payments made by insurance companies amounted to 35.168 million manats ($20.7 million), 2.1-fold more than a year ago.
In January 2023, 26.3 manats ($15.47) were paid for every 100 manats ($58.82) collected in the insurance market. In the same period last year, this figure was 14.1 manats ($8.3).
